반응형
  • 뒤로가기
<a href="javascript:history.back();">뒤로 가기</a>

 

혹은 아래와 같이 따로 함수를 만들어서 사용 가능합니다.

<script type="text/javascript">
	var goBack = function(){
    	window.history.back();
        // history.back(); 처럼 window. 생략 가능
    }
</script>
<a href="#" onclick="goBack();">뒤로</a>

 

  • 앞으로 가기
<a href="javascript:history.forward();">앞으로 가기</a>

 

  • 원하는 페이지 수만큼 이동하기

window.history.go() 함수를 이용하여 원하는 페이지 수만큼 이동을 할 수 있다.

<script type="text/javascript">
	
    // 앞으로 n 페이지만큼 이동
    var goForward = function(n){
    	window.history.go(n);
    }
    
    // 뒤로 n 페이지만큼 이동
    var goBack = function(n){
    	window.history.go(-n);
    }
    
</script>

 

window.history.go(n);

n 값이 양수일 경우에 앞으로 가기, n 값이 음수일 경우에는 뒤로 이동하게 됩니다.

반응형

+ Recent posts